ITU launches ‘The Global Network Resiliency Platform’

A specialised agency of the United Nations- International Telecommunication Union (ITU) launched ‘The Global Network Resiliency Platform’.

The platform aims to ensure availability of telecommunication services during the ongoing coronavirus crisis. The new platform will assist governments and the private sector by ensuring that the networks are kept strong and telecommunication services are made available to all.
